Main Responsibilities:

  • Maintain full bookkeeping and accounting records, including purchase ledger, sales ledger, and general ledger, using cloud-based accounting software.
  • Prepare monthly Balance Sheet reconciliations, including bank, sales ledger, purchase ledger, Intercompany, accruals, and prepayments.
  • Compile and present the monthly management accounts pack to the management team.
  • Prepare and file quarterly VAT returns in a timely manner.
  • Perform bank reconciliations in multiple currencies.
  • Regularly review the sales and purchase ledgers for overdue amounts and address any outstanding issues.
  • Conduct credit control activities, including chasing outstanding debt.
  • Drive and support continuous improvement initiatives by assisting in the development and documentation of new processes.
  • Prepare analysis and reports for management to facilitate timely, fact-based business decisions.
  • Review time reports and cost/profit analysis, and request explanations for variances as needed.
  • Perform general office management duties as required to support the smooth operation of the finance department.
  • Complete special projects and other responsibilities as assigned by the management team.
  • Undertake other ad-hoc duties as assigned to meet the needs of the business
